Also, just like my sister Elizabeth, I have to take Lovenox shots because of our Factor V Leiden. Currently I'm on 2 shots a day, one every 12 hours, of 30mg. If you are wonder what the heck Factor V Leiden is you can Google it or take my short and sweet explanation: It's a genetic mutation that causes my blood to clot 3-8 times more than the average person. The Lovenox is an anti-coagulant aka blood thinner and is taken in the stomach subcutaneously. Pregnancy is a dangerous time for blood clots in normal women so it's even more dangerous for people with Factor V Leiden. I only have 1 gene, heterozygous, so my dosage is for prophylactic (precautionary) reasons. I do have to be careful and I have to stop flying way before 36 weeks.
